In the UK, consumers have seven days after delivery to change their mind about an online purchase and have the full cost including delivery refunded:

It's a pretty powerful consumer right - I'm guessing one reason it doesn't get abused is that the process of returning items has a small cost involved, even if that's just walking to the post office or waiting for a courier to pick a package up.
